Android 7.0 Nougat features

Android 7.0 Nougat is the latest Android OS for smartphones. Some of its thrilling new features include Multi-window, Quick Switch and Daydream (VR).

Multi-window can be used to access two apps in the same screen at the same time. While Quick Switch with the use of multi-tasking button can be used to switch between applications. Daydream promises more immersive VR experience.
